10 даром
нареч. разг.1) ( бесплатно) for nothing, gratis, free (of charge)рабо́тать да́ром — work for nothing [without remuneration]
2) ( очень дёшево) for next to nothing; for a trifle, for a songза таку́ю це́ну - э́то всё равно́ что да́ром — at this price it's a giveaway / gift брит.
3) ( бесполезно) in vain, to no purposeэ́то не прошло́ да́ром — it was not in vain, it had its effect
да́ром тра́тить что-л — waste smth
весь день да́ром пропа́л — the whole day has been wasted
его́ уси́лия не пропа́ли да́ром — his efforts were not in vain [not wasted]
э́тот уро́к не прошёл для них да́ром — the lesson was not lost on them
••да́ром что — though, although
э́то ему́ да́ром не пройдёт — he will not get away with it; this will not go unpunished
э́то так да́ром не пройдёт — the matter will not rest there
э́то ему́ не да́ром доста́лось — he did not get it without any trouble; it cost him something
э́того мне и да́ром не на́до — I wouldn't take it as a gift; I wouldn't take it if they paid me
да́ром есть (свой) хлеб — ≈ not be worth one's salt
